Ann E.
Armour
June 1, 1924 – December 24, 2018
Ann E. Armour, 94, of Superior, died Monday, December 24, 2018 at St. Luke's Hospital in Duluth.
Ann was born on June 1, 1924 the daughter of Thomas and Katarina Fudally.
She married Robert E. Armour and they raised six children together. She was a tireless assistant to Bob's historical research on Superior, a subject on which he published 2 books.
She was a very talented artist and belonged to the Old Town Artist Group. She was an active member of Cathedral Church and had taught religious education. Ann had also served as an election official in Superior. Most important to her was her family and she was a beloved caregiver to many of her family members.
